Revenue Streams and Profit Margins Across Platforms
Each marketplace generates revenue differently, affecting your net worth of albaba amazon ebay in distinct ways. On Amazon, subscription fees, referral commissions, and fulfillment costs create a predictable but competitive margin structure. eBay relies heavily on final value fees and insertions, which can erode profits on fast-moving items.
Alibaba sourcing shifts the focus to bulk procurement margins and landed costs, including shipping, tariffs, and quality control. Balancing these channels allows you to optimize cash flow and protect overall net worth.
Valuation Methods for Marketplace Accounts
Valuing your accounts starts with hard metrics like trailing twelve month revenue, average selling price, and net profit after platform fees. Multiples vary by category, with Amazon FBA businesses often commanding higher valuations due to scalability and asset-light fulfillment options.
eBay accounts are typically valued on a transaction basis, focusing on repeat buyer rates and feedback scores. Alibaba sourcing operations are judged on supplier relationships, minimum order quantities, and logistics efficiency, all of which impact net worth calculations.
Inventory Management and Cash Flow Impact
Holding too much stock on Amazon or eBay ties up capital and increases risk of markdowns, while lean Alibaba orders can improve turnover but may create stockout risk. Strong inventory turnover ratios boost your net worth by reducing storage fees and minimizing obsolete stock.
Using safety stock formulas, reorder points, and demand forecasting helps you maintain optimal liquidity across all three platforms. Coordinated replenishment between Alibaba suppliers and marketplace listings protects cash flow and stabilizes long term net worth.
Risk Management and Compliance Factors
Policy violations, account suspensions, and changes in platform fees can sharply reduce your net worth of albaba amazon ebay overnight. Diversifying across Amazon, eBay, and Alibaba spreads risk, but you still need robust compliance routines for each ecosystem.
Monitoring intellectual property claims, counterfeit concerns, and shipping restrictions helps you avoid costly disruptions. Conservative accounting, clear reserve funds, and documented supplier contracts add resilience to your overall valuation.

How do I calculate my net worth across Amazon, eBay, and Alibaba?
Add cash, inventory, and receivables from each platform, then subtract outstanding loans, platform fees owed, and payables related to sourcing and shipping to determine your net worth.
Which platform typically contributes most to net worth growth?
Amazon FBA often drives the strongest long term growth because of its large audience, fulfillment network, and scalable product margins compared to eBay and direct sourcing via Alibaba.
Can changes in Alibaba sourcing costs affect my overall net worth?
Yes, increases in shipping, tariffs, or supplier prices directly impact your cost of goods sold and margins, which lowers net worth unless you adjust pricing or find alternative suppliers.
What inventory metrics should I watch to protect my net worth?
Track inventory turnover, days of stock, and sell-through rate to avoid overstocking on Amazon or eBay and to align Alibaba orders with actual marketplace demand.
